In 2024, MDLBEAST Foundation initiatives made significant strides in empowering the music ecosystem in the MENA region. Key highlights include:XP Music Futures: Hosted the fourth edition of the premier music conference in the region, bringing together industry experts, artists, producers, labels, and music enthusiasts. Pioneering New Milestones in 2025 XP Music Futures conference will return for its fifth edition, bringing together industry experts, artists, producers, labels, and music enthusiasts for the region's leading three-day music conference. This flagship event remains central to our mission of scaling the music industry across MENA.Hearful: Our hearing health awareness initiative conducted over 140 hearing tests and diagnosed 13 individuals with hearing difficulties in 2024, emphasizing the importance of hearing health awareness. The initiative focusing on tinnitus awareness and prevention, will continue its mission of safeguarding hearing health. In collaboration with Arabtone, we aim to expand our efforts to offer hearing tests and provide earplugs at XP and Soundstorm events.
XCHANGE: a dynamic series of workshops touring the Middle East, hosted sessions in Kuwait City, Tunis, and Muscat throughout 2024, bringing together over 200 music professionals and fostering regional collaboration. XCHANGE kicked off its 2025 tour on February 6th in Manama, Bahrain, marking the start of an expanded journey across the region. The tour will continue in Doha, Marrakech, and Riyadh, providing a platform for industry professionals to connect, exchange ideas, and drive the music scene forward. Each city will host a Hunna gathering, bringing together women in the industry for collective forums.
The workshop in Manama, titled 'Musician & Multi-Disciplinary Creative Artist Performing,' will feature a distinguished lineup of panelists, including Ali Zayani, Co-founder of Soundscapes; Mashael Fairooz, Founding Partner of JEO Capital Management; Lance Tobin, Vice President of Booking at Al Dana Amphitheatre; and Wrista, Recording Artist & Founder of L.O.A.D.B Productions.
Sound Futures: XP Sound Futures initiative connects eligible music startups with investors to drive innovation in the music ecosystem. In 2024, six startups pitched to investors at XP, and we will open a new call for applications in March 2025. This initiative is a cornerstone of our efforts to expand business opportunities within the music industry.PWR CHORD: Launched in 2024 at XP Music Futures, PWR CHORD featured 10 talented guitarists performing before a panel of six renowned judges, including world-famous guitarists. The winner received a unique signed guitar from Megadeth's lead guitarist, marking a major milestone in their career.XPERFORM: Discovered and elevated fresh talent, offering a platform for new voices, with Lamia Khattab winning in 2024 and earning a performance at Soundstorm'24 and a 2025 collaboration with MDLBEAST Records. Lamia Khattab won and stood out amongst more than 1000 individuals representing more than 36 nationalities. Returning for its fourth edition to discover and elevate fresh new voices.Storm Shaker: The search for the next breakthrough DJ returns in 2025, culminating in a thrilling final competition at XP in December. The winner will debut at Soundstorm and embark on an international tour as the grand prize. Last year's winner, Saadoon, is already scheduled to perform in O- -Beach Dubai, EXIT Festival, MOGA, and BSMNT The Club, after performing at Soundstorm.Artist Management Bootcamp: Graduated 35 participants, equipping them with comprehensive artist management knowledge, with top graduates securing internships at Sony Music, Warner Music, and MDLBEAST Records, nurturing the next generation of industry leaders, We aim to expand this program further in 2025, empowering future leaders in the industry.In its mission to scale and empower the regional music ecosystem, MDLBEAST's XP has outlined a series of impactful initiatives for 2025, including the continuation of Hearful to promote hearing health, the launch of XCHANGE workshops in 3 new destinations, Manama, Doha & Marrakesh to foster collaboration and support women in the industry through Hunna gatherings, and the expansion of Sound Futures to connect music startups with investors. Emotions on loop
Having recently embarked on an 'experimental' journey with her latest single Down Bad, Bahraini singer Noora Almoosa aka Goodth_ngs has big hopes for its official release this year. Last month, the 27-year-old gave fans in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ia, a taste of the creation, among others in her set list, as she participated for the first time in the famed XP Music Futures conference. In November, the artist opened with the track for Canadian-Bahraini duo Majid Jordan at Beyon Al Dana Amphitheatre, and the composition has been 'shaping up' with every performance. 'It started as a three-note guitar thing and I'm singing over it. It's kind of like spoken word poetry, almost and I'm singing here and there,' Noora told GulfWeekly. 'But then, because I was curious about live looping, and I wanted to incorporate it, I borrowed my friend's loop equipment and I started playing around with it, and I asked her if I can use it for my next show, which at the time was in Kuwait,' the Berklee Abu Dhabi alumna, who attended the music school's Performing Artists and Leadership programme in 2023, added. Live looping is a playing technique based on loops which are recorded during the performance. It's a way to compose in real time, or 'near real time' since the loops are recorded seconds or minutes before they are heard. 'I remember telling the audience, 'by the way, the performance is experimental' because I still do not know how to use it. Over time, I got more confident and that song built because of that experience. 'The composition had a natural evolvement through time and, mirrors the time that I am in, as it developed from almost a spoken word piece to a live looping piece that came to be through my experiences, practising for shows and performing live around the region in 2024. 'I've never done live looping before and this has been a growing part of my practice especially as a solo artist,' the A'ali resident revealed. 'I believe it's like, you're always thinking 'what more can I do?'. Sometimes you shock yourself, with where you start with a body of work, and then where you take it. Trusting and allowing myself to play has been the main part of the whole experience,' she added. While she continues to work towards the official release of the track, the former corporate junkie is grateful for the opportunities she had especially in the last year, with live performances that make her feel 'in her element', regardless of the artistic challenges she sets for herself. 'I think, performances and live shows are my favourite part of being an artist, because I feel very at home doing it. My first love has always been being on stage. 'I am really grateful for the path I am on of learning, playing, exploring, creating and releasing my projects, doing bigger stages in Bahrain and around the Gulf region, as well as talking and connecting with people through the experiences. It's been the blessing in my evolving artistry. 'I've also come to appreciate the different hats I've worn as an artist, like organically considering visuals and the artwork as well as the more operational and business side of things as it's a part of it (musical career), but my focus will always come back to my music and practice of it. 'Letting it speak for me and grow with me, I've learned to be really confident in my abilities and lean on my community, which I'm very grateful for.'
